Engineered Flooring

One such flooring type that has caught our eye is engineered flooring. It is a type of flooring that has grown in popularity in recent years over the traditional wood flooring. Engineered flooring is comprised of multiple layers of compressed timber, finished with a top layer of solid wood veneer. It ends up looking as good as traditional wood flooring but with the knowledge that you also have that extra stability. A great option all round.

Solid Wood Flooring

Solid wood flooring is another type we have considered. Although it is not as stable as the more modern engineered flooring, it is absolutely beautiful and natural (made from 100% wood product) and is the right choice for you if you want your home to have a nice warm and rustic feel.

Laminate Flooring

Obviously home renovations can cost quite a bit so sometimes it is best to look for the cheaper but still good quality option which is where laminate flooring comes in. Made to be similar in appearance to the wood and stone flooring available, they actually consist of several different levels of a variety of materials. This is a great option if you are trying to renovate on a budget but still want your house to look great. Cheap or cheaper doesn’t have to mean shoddy quality, there are some great laminate styles out there.
